2. How do you view interracial couples in -game-? Specifically, let's not get into a debate about whether or not it's 'gross' to you as a person or if there are too many people doing it.
The lore obviously supports interracial boinking, at least as far as prostitution is concerned, so I don't see why not. Some couples may be... difficult... mostly due to body differences (I'm looking specifically at Lalafells and... anyone else), but seriously - every humanoid race can communicate, which by default means they can bond, which by default also means they can bond romantically. Physical attraction would factor in, so interracial couples may be less common, but they certainly seem possible to me.

2. How does your character view interracial pairings and are their feelings different from your own?
She is tribeless, as far as she is aware, because her parents broke a tribal rule (she was sired by a Tia) and were cast out, so she has certain... reservations about couples which may be considered taboo. I'm not sure whether or not interracial couples would be taboo in every single case, or at all, but she would be wary of anything that is outside of the conventional, since she saw how it affected her parents and, of course, how it personally affected her as their child.
Worth noting she does not believe she herself should be in a relationship, interracial or no.
